What Are Company Research Tools?

Company research tools are software solutions that aggregate, process, and analyze data about businesses to provide actionable insights for sales and marketing teams. These platforms, often called sales intelligence tools, automate the research process and allow teams to identify and qualify high-potential prospects efficiently.

These tools provide several key data types: firmographics (descriptive attributes like industry, company size, and location), technographics (information about a company’s technology stack), and intent data (behavioral signals indicating active research on specific products or services).

What Are the Different Types of Company Research Tools?

Company research tools can be segmented into five main categories based on their primary function:

  • Sales Intelligence & B2B Data Platforms provide access to extensive databases of company and contact information, including firmographics, technographics, and verified contact details.
  • Intent Data Platforms identify accounts actively researching products or services by tracking digital buying signals across the web to prioritize outreach to in-market accounts.
  • Competitive & Market Intelligence Platforms provide market landscape views, industry trends, and competitor activities through website analytics and social media monitoring.
  • Financial Data Platforms specialize in detailed financial analysis of public and private companies, including funding rounds and analyst ratings.
  • Market Research & Survey Tools collect primary data directly from target audiences through surveys and feedback collection.

Cognism

Cognism is a leading sales intelligence platform with strong focus on GDPR-compliant data, particularly for EMEA and US markets. Known for its phone-verified “Diamond Data®” with 87% accuracy and claimed connect rates of 15-20% in the US.

The platform operates on an unrestricted access model with annual contracts, avoiding credit-based systems. It emphasizes compliance with GDPR and CCPA, scrubbing data against multiple Do-Not-Call lists.

Bombora

Bombora is a leading provider of B2B buyer intent data, showing which businesses are actively researching specific topics online. Its core product, Company Surge®, identifies businesses actively researching products or services by analyzing content consumption across over 5,500 B2B publisher websites.

The platform measures when a company’s research on specific topics significantly increases compared to historical baselines, scoring this ‘surge’ to help teams prioritize accounts for outreach and advertising.

Clearbit (now part of HubSpot)

Following its acquisition by HubSpot in late 2023, Clearbit is no longer available as a standalone product for new customers. Its features have been integrated into HubSpot as ‘Breeze Intelligence’ with a credit-based model.

The data enrichment capabilities now cost 10 HubSpot Credits per enrichment, with credits priced at $10 per 1,000. Legacy free tools were sunset on April 30, 2025.

How to Choose the Right Company Research Tool

Choosing the right company research platform requires a systematic evaluation based on your specific needs and constraints. Here’s a comprehensive checklist to guide your decision:

Data Quality, Coverage, and Freshness should be your first consideration. Evaluate the provider’s claimed accuracy rate for contact data, their verification process (combination of AI tools and human verification), refresh rate (data decays by 22-30% per year, so daily or weekly updates are crucial), and coverage of your target market, geographic regions, and company sizes.

Core Features and Functionality must align with your use case. Assess search and filtering granularity, specific data types needed (contact data, intent signals, competitive insights, financial data), actionable insights like alerts for buying signals, and analytics and reporting capabilities.

Integration and Ease of Use can make or break adoption. Ensure seamless CRM integration with platforms like Salesforce or HubSpot, evaluate the user interface for your team’s technical comfort level, and verify robust API access for custom integrations.

Pricing, Scalability, and ROI require careful analysis. Understand the pricing structure (per-user, credit-based, flat subscription, or usage-based), evaluate scalability for future growth, and establish an ROI measurement framework based on improved conversion rates and time savings.

Compliance, Security, and Support are non-negotiable for enterprise buyers. Verify GDPR and CCPA compliance, security standards like SOC 2 or ISO 27001, and customer support quality with structured onboarding processes.
